Description
The individual chosen for this position will be a member of an engineering team responsible for characterizing parts and maintaining automation tools. The selected candidate will be involved in testing parts and developing tools in the lab, creating setups, and evaluating results. Additionally, we will be improving the current RF Test Systems' Hardware, Software, and Monitoring System Performance to guarantee Accuracy and Repeatability. The successful candidate will be an effective problem solver, proactive process owner, and insightful test program developer.
Term: Summer/Fall (June '26 - Dec '26)
Responsibilities
- Maintain and troubleshoot the existing automation tool
- Develop automated solutions to support the team in reducing manual effort
- Document the bug fixes or new features to ensure timely updates
– Work from schematic, diagrams, written, and verbal descriptions
– Assist in determining methods for time reduction
– Building RF test setups and harnesses
– Perform RF tests, evaluating standard RF devices, including but not limited to amplifiers, filters, couplers, etc.
Required Experience and Skills
- Currently enrolled in electrical engineering, pursuing a BS or MS degree
- Experience with programming environments such as NI LabVIEW, MATLAB, Python, etc. (use for instrument control is a plus)
- Experience with designing OOP solutions for the purpose of lab automation
- Not necessary but a plus: Use of MySQL and TortoiseSVN for database/repository maintenance.
– Must be proactive and improve test benches and provide feedback for test procedures and test programs
– Knowledge of RF test equipment: multi-meter, Oscilloscope, Signal Generators, Power meter, etc..
– Troubleshooting and problem-solving abilities
– Ability to understand schematics and diagrams
– Must have a team-oriented attitude, accountability, and ownership
– Understanding of RF Technology
